Local public commenters tell Bulloch County commissioners they’ve filed affidavits alleging unconstitutional charging practices and child‑removal profiteering

Bulloch County Board of Commissioners · January 21, 2026

Three speakers at the Bulloch County meeting said they served the board with affidavits alleging that Georgia charging practices and family‑court removals deprive citizens of rights; speakers urged reporting to federal authorities and presented criminal‑statute citations and case references.

At the start of the Feb. 3 meeting, three public commenters told Bulloch County commissioners they had submitted legal notices and affidavits alleging constitutional violations in local criminal and family courts.
